After the Jessica Lynch debacle and after reading her account of what happened and how much it differed from the "official" version by the Army I am not suprised to learn that the Army's stories about Pat Tillman's death were also greatly exaggerated.

As it turns out, he was not even killed by the enemy, he was killed by American soldiers who were mistakenly firing on the Afgan soldier that Tillman was with.

What irritates me the most about the current situation in America is how Dishonest the government repeatedly is, and how apathetic the American people are about that fact. Nobody cares that the government lies anymore. They almost expect it and when it does happen the only reaction is shrugging shoulders and a sigh.
